Alun Loan Extended? Sun 11th Jan 2004 19:04
Bradford boss Bryan Robson says he is keen to extend Alun Armstrong's loan spell with the West Yorkshire club. Armstrong scored the winner on Saturday as the Bantams defeated Norwich City 1-0.
Collins Off as U19s Draw Sat 10th Jan 2004 19:36
A ten-man Town U19 side drew 1-1 at home to Wimbledon on Saturday morning. Central defender Aidan Collins harshly saw red in the second half for a professional foul.

Vogts Watches Miller Sat 10th Jan 2004 19:15
Scotland boss Bertie Vogts watched Town midfielder Tommy Miller in action against Reading on Saturday afternoon. Vogts also kept an eye on Scott Murray, Graeme Murty and Andy Hughes who were playing for the Royals.
Joe: Town Shot-Shy Sat 10th Jan 2004 19:04
Town boss Joe Royle bemoaned his side's lack of shots after the Blues drew 1-1 with Reading at the Madejski Stadium. Royle felt that Town ought to have taken three points back to Suffolk.
Reading 1 - 1 Town Sat 10th Jan 2004 18:19
Town continued their unbeaten away record, which stretches back to September, with a 1-1 draw at Reading. The home side took the lead through Lloyd Owusu on 61 but the Blues hit back via John McGreal 11 minutes later, the central defender netting his first goal of the season.
